Bowmore 44 Years Gold Edition
This unique kind of bottling was distilled on the 5th of Novermber 1964 and directly bottled into three Bourbon and one Oloroso sherry cask. The 44 years of maturation in the famous vault no. 1 grew a very special kind of Scotch.
The Gold is the last of the Trilogie: Black, White, Gold.
Nose: Complex with a lot of vanilla and papaya and passion fruit
Taste: An explosion of ripe and exotic fruits, creamy with vanilla and peat smoke
Finish: A lot of layers to taste through. Very nicely balanced.
